AEW Rankings For 1/22: Nyla Rose Tops Women’s Rankings, Omega & Page Leap To #1 In Tag Division

All Elite Wrestling has released another week of official AEW rankings for the men’s, women’s, and tag team divisions.

PAC jumped up two spots in the men’s division, while Cody and Kenny Omega also shuffled around in the rankings. The women’s division also saw some movement as Nyla Rose became the new number one ranked wrestler, taking over the top spot from Hikaru Shida. Ahead of their tag team title match on tonight’s episode of Dynamite, Adam Page and Kenny Omega also jumped three spots from #4 to top the tag team division charts; The Dark Order also joined the tag rankings at #4 while Best Friends dropped off from the third spot.

See the full list for each division below:

Men’s Division

(Singles record in 2020, overall AEW record)

Champion: Chris Jericho (0-0, 8-1-1)

1. Jon Moxley (2-0, 7-1-1)

2. Pac (1-0, 6-4-1)

3. Cody (1-0, 8-3-1)

4. Kenny Omega (0-0, 12-5)

5. Sammy Guevara (2-1, 6-7)

Women’s Division

(Singles record in 2020, overall AEW record)

Champion: Riho (2-0, 10-2)

1. Nyla Rose (1-1, 5-4)

2. Hikaru Shida (1-1, 5-4)

3. Kris Statlander (0-1, 4-3)

4. Awesome Kong (1-0, 3-1)

5. Britt Baker (0-1, 7-5)

Tag Team Division

(Tag team record in 2020, overall AEW record)

Champions: SCU (0-0 / Kaz 12-3, Sky 13-4)

1. Kenny Omega & Hangman Page (2-0 / Omega 12-5, Page 8-7)

2. Santana & Ortiz (0-1 / 5-4)

3. The Young Bucks (0-1 / Matt 10-6, Nick 10-7)

4. The Dark Order (1-0 / 5-2)

5. Lucha Bros (0-1 / Penta 7-8, Fenix 8-8)
